Benefits of starting a business in the UAE:

Tax Benefits:

The UAE is known for its tax-friendly environment, and it is one of the significant factors that attract business owners and investors. The UAE does not impose personal income tax. In freezone, there are no import/export taxes and corporate tax rate is 0%. In mainland, the corporate tax is 9% for businesses exceeding AED 375,000.

Moreover, the UAE has close contract with various countries such as Double Taxation Avoidance Agreements (DTAA), making it easier for businesses to avoid double taxation operating under two jurisdictions. Streamlined tax affairs UAE with different countries is a key factor to perform international business activities without any disruption.

Freezone Benefits:

The UAE offers 45+ free zone for business setup and each has numerous benefits making it an attractive choice for company formation. The free zone offers 100% ownership with the rate of 0% corporate tax. Company formation in free zone provides the business owners with the advantage of full repatriation of capital and profits, and exemptions in import/export duties.

Types Of Business Licenses for Company Formation In UAE

1. Commercial Licenses

For businesses, that are involved in any sort of trade activities, related to goods, commodities and services, it is crucial to obtain a commercial license. Before applying for a license, businesses must decide the activities they conduct and choose appropriate license that suits their business nature. 

2. Industrial License

Business that conducts activities like production and manufacturing of goods or any other industrial activities in the UAE must obtain the industrial license. 

The manufacturing of following products needs to be conducted under Industrial License

  • Food
  • Equipment and engines
  • Petroleum products
  • Textile
  • Metals
  • Paper

3. Professional License

For professionals who wants to engage in an activity based on their talent and educational qualification, must perform under a professional license. Investors can obtain 100% ownership of their business with a professional license. The following activities can be conducted under a professional license:

  • Printing And Publishing
  • Medical Services
  • Consultancy Services
  • Beauty Salons
  • Computer Graphic Design Service
  • Artisan Ship
  • Carpentry
  • Repair Services
  • Security Services
  • Document Clearing

4. Tourism License

Businesses that conduct activities such as renting of hotels, boat rental, tourist camps, restaurant services, guest accommodation, and travel agencies etc should operate under a trade license.

5. Agriculture License

The people who are involved in the following activities should apply for an agricultural license: 

  • Cultivation And Harvesting of Crops
  • Trading Of Pesticides, Crops Etc
  • Installation Of Greenhouses 
  • Agricultural Consultancy Services

6. Craftsmanship license

Individuals should get a craftmanship license to provide following services

  • Plumbing
  • Carpentry
  • Electrical Work etc.

It is mandatory to obtain a trade license for setting up a business in Dubai or Across UAE, otherwise you may face a hefty penalty or even a ban from conducting the activity. Moreover, the license is valid for one year and need to be renewed to avoid penalties. 

Documents Required for Company Formation in UAE

The following documents are needed to register a company in UAE:

  • Passport and Visa Copies of all the Shareholders, including Directors 
  • A Detailed Business plan 
  • License Application Form 
  • Memorandum of Association (MOA) 
  • Articles of Association (AOA) 
  • Trade Name Reservation Certificate 
  • Office Lease Agreement 
  • Bank Statements 
  • Registry Identification Code Form (RIC) for the Appointed Manager and 
  • Other Financial Documents (if required)

Steps To Register a Company in the UAE

Select the Business Activity

Choose the business activity for your company as it determines the regulations and requirements for company formation process in the UAE. It is crucial to decide on the main services/operations of your business to choose an activity.

Choose the Legal Structure

The UAE offers various business structures to choose based on your operational needs, the business setup zone and company requirements. Select the right type of legal structure for your business from these options: Limited Liability Company (LLC), Civil Company, Sole Proprietorship, Private Joint Stock Company, and Branch Company.

Pick the Trade Name of Your Company

Select a unique and relevant trade name for your business that not only reflects your brand identity but also comply with the naming conventions based on the UAE regulations. The name shouldn’t be registered before and needs to be approved by the licensing authorities.

Apply for a Business License

Once you’ve selected the suitable name for your business, you need to apply for a business license to operate in the UAE. Choose the right type of business license that suits your business activity. The Department of Economic Development (DED) is responsible for issuance of business licenses for businesses in the UAE.

Gather The Documents & Get Initial Approval

The next step is to obtain approval from the licensing authorities, which denotes no objection to your business by the UAE government. You should gather all the required information and documents and submit to the relevant authorities and departments for initial approvals.

Open A Bank Account

In order to perform all your business-related transactions and handle your business finances, you need a corporate bank account. Open a bank account for your business in any of the UAE-based banks.
